At Southcoast Health, we have a team of neurologists, neurosurgeons, radiologists, certified stroke nurses and more to assist with rapid stroke care in Fall River, Dartmouth and Wareham, MA at our hospital locations.

Our award-winning stroke care program is certified by the American Heart Association/American Stroke Association (AHA/ASA) and can treat people with stroke-related conditions such as subarachnoid hemorrhage or TIA (transient ischemic attack or “mini-stroke.”

  • Aneurysm — bulging of a blood vessel in the brain that can rupture and bleed
  • AVM (arteriovenous malformation) — a tangle of blood vessels in the brain
  • Stroke — either ischemic or hemorrhagic
  • Subarachnoid hemorrhage — bleeding into the space between the brain and its covering
  • TIA (transient ischemic attack or “mini-stroke”)

  • Clot-busting medicines and catheter-based procedures
  • Antithrombotic therapy for ischemic stroke patients
  • Anticoagulant therapy for ischemic stroke patients with atrial fibrillation or flutter
  • Statin medications for patients with LDL, or “bad” cholesterol, of 100 mg/dL or greater
  • Stroke education for patients and caregivers
  • Stroke rehabilitation assessments

If you are noticing signs of stroke, such as sudden confusion, numbness or weakness, a severe headache and dizziness, come to our emergency department as soon as possible. Our team can determine the cause and severity of stroke and quickly apply the proper treatment. Timing is the most important factor in stroke care and recovery.
